Soil pesticide contamination induced by modern agriculture has become a serious global issue. Its uncontrolled and inefficient application is among the main reasons for their enrichment in plants animals subsequently transferred to humans providing public health risk. Biochar as renewable economical carbonaceous material provides natural solution immobilizing pesticides improving soil health. The biochar impact agricultural contaminated governed various factors such physico-chemical properties of biochar, pyrolysis, conditions, method, which can lead significant gaps removal or mitigation toxic substances. current study summarizes negative effects use advantages according other remediation techniques, succeeded mechanism controlling on minimizing leaching bioavailability soil. In addition, role fundamental processes adsorption, desorption, biodegradation, discussed. Ultimately, major future research regulation key strategies that are pesticide-contaminated proposed.

The periodically excessive use of pesticides in agricultural production has caused eco-toxicity and environmental pollution issues. Developing analytical methods for that respond to the growing need perform rapid, situ analysis showed bio-sensing technique as a complementary tool classical chromatographic measurements screening. Compared with traditional solid-state electrode, screen-printed electrode (SPE) owns merits low cost, easier integration, versatility, portability, smaller sizes mass-produce, it been widely applied detection. Herein, first section this review briefly introduces definition screen-printing (SPT) preparation procedure, printing materials advantages SPE, discusses most important physical chemical SPE activation. It then summarizes current utilization focus on various available bioreceptors nanomaterials modified sensors biosensors, novel approach detection (including organophosphorus (OPs), carbamate (CPs), herbicide (HPs)). Furthermore, also covers sensing principles SPE-based along their performance, shortcomings. Finally, challenges future directions electrochemical pollutants are outlined.
